Little Passports is quite a unique concept. Children receive a package every month that contains information about a different destination along with postcards and travel souvenirs from their new traveling pen pals Sam and Sofia.

I did not tell my children about Little Passports so when they received a package in the mail with their names on it they where so surprised. They where both super excited to open it and discover the Explorer Kit which included a letter from Little Passports globetrotting characters Sam and Sofia along with a world map, a travel passport, stickers, activity sheets and access to online games and activities. We also got one of the monthly packages; each one of these contains information from a different destination.  On this occasion we got a letter from Sam and Sofia telling us all about Argentina and both of my children where excited to learn more about another country where Spanish is spoken.  The kit also included a little pin sticker that you can place on the world map to mark every destination that you learn about.  My daughter could not stop talking about all the places she wanted to learn about and eventually visit.  I do not know where she gets this from. 😉  Who knew wanderlust could be inherited.
